Steps
Prepare Vegetables
Dice the onion, carrots, and celery into small pieces. Mince the garlic. Dice the zucchini and cut the green beans into smaller pieces.
Sauté Aromatics
In a large pot or Dutch oven, heat 2 tablespoons of olive oil over medium heat. Add the diced onion, carrots, and celery, and sauté for 5-7 minutes until softened. Add the minced garlic, oregano, and basil, and cook for another 1 minute until fragrant.
Simmer Soup Base
Pour in the canned diced tomatoes and vegetable broth.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at to medium-low and simmer for 10 minutes to allow the flavors to meld.
Add Remaining Vegetables and Pasta
Add the diced zucchini, green beans, and drained, rinsed cannellini beans. Cook for another 5-7 minutes until the vegetables are almost tender. Then, add the small pasta and cook according to package directions until al dente (usually 7-10 minutes).
Finish with Spinach and Season
Remove from heat and stir in the fresh spinach until it wilts. Season with sal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ste.
Make Pesto Toast
While the soup is simmering, toast the bread slices in a pan or toaster. Spread each slice with pesto, then sprinkle with grated Parmesan cheese.
Serve
Ladle the hot minestrone soup into bowls. Serve with the pesto toast on the side, and if desired, garnish with extra grated Parmesan.
Extra Tips
► Don't overcook the pasta in the soup, or it will become mushy. Add it towards the end of cooking and cook only until al dente.
► Use fresh, seasonal vegetables for the best flavor.
► Prepare the pesto toast just before serving to keep it crispy.
